- ベストアンサー
DNSサーバーへの問合せの確認方法
複数のクライアントPC存在するLAN環境で、1台だけ突然インターネット接続できなくなりました。Windows2003サーバーがドメインコントローラーとDNSサーバーを兼ねており、クライアントはWinXPです。社内のDNSサーバーは契約しているISPのDNSサーバーへフォワードするだけです。 インターネットにつながらないのは名前解決できないのが理由だというところまでは確認できました。IP直打ちであればつながりますし、LAN内の名前解決はできています。 当該PCのTCP/IPのプロパティでDNSを自動取得から直指定に変えてみたりしてみましたが、どうしても名前解決できません。DNSサーバーに対して正しく問合せが出来ているかどうかの確認はどうやったらできるかご存知の方がいらしたら教えてください。
- みんなの回答 (3)
- 専門家の回答
質問者が選んだベストアンサー
DNSキャッシュのクリアやhostsファイルの内容を確認してみましょう。 マルウェアやファーミングによる不具合の可能性があります。 http://www.exconn.net/Forums/ShowPost.aspx?PostID=4402 http://e-words.jp/w/DNSE382ADE383A3E38383E382B7E383A5E383BBE3839DE382A4E382BAE3838BE383B3E382B0.html http://e-words.jp/w/hostsE38395E382A1E382A4E383AB.html
その他の回答 (2)
- jjon-com
- ベストアンサー率61% (1599/2592)
社内からとのことですが,Proxyサーバを介したWebアクセスでしょうか。 であるなら,Internet Explorerのインターネットオプション→詳細設定の ・HTTP1.1を使用する ・プロキシ接続でHTTP1.1を使用する が他の正常PCと合っているかどうか確認しておく必要があるでしょう。 Webプロキシを介した場合,DNS名前解決をするのはProxyサーバなので。 http://okwave.jp/qa4063828.html の私の過去の回答ANo.3
補足
回答ありがとうございます。 Proxyは使っていません。 インターネットオプションの設定も見直しましたが、特におかしいところはありませんでした。
- ann_dv
- ベストアンサー率43% (528/1223)
nslookupコマンドを使用します。
補足
アドバイスありがとうございます。 さっそくまともなPCと比較してみましたが、d2オプションを使ってyahoo.co.jpに対して検索をかけてみたら同じ結果が返ってきました(ちゃんとIPアドレスを返してきた)。 DNSサーバーからはしかるべき答えが返ってきているがダメPCはそれを受け止められていないという事になるのでしょうか? 他にチェックすべき箇所はありますでしょうか? ちなみにドメイン名でpingを飛ばそうとするとその時点でダメPCは名前解決できませんでした。
お礼
DNSのキャッシュのクリアは知りませんでした。 参考にさせていただきます。